- [ ] Verify soft-delete behavior on the orders table before sealing the ceremony record. Rows flagged deleted_at in Cartwheel Commerce must never be purged during key rotation, since the escrow tooling replays order history to validate signatures. If the replay job finds hard-deleted rows, the ceremony is void and must restart. Once verified, record the escrow credential below this item for future maintainers.

unlock words, hahip-baduf: holwyn-istath-julvan

Ticket: Crashfall ingest failing on staging

New folks, please read carefully. The Pebblekit mobile app's crash reports aren't reaching the symbolication queue because staging's env file was copied without its upload credential. Symptoms: 401s in the collector logs every five minutes. To fix, add the missing line to the env file, exactly as follows.

secret setting of fafop-tagep: VAULT_KEY29=6a815d21e2d77cc25ef1802d73ee6

// NOTE for release: the Pixelbarn image cache in thumbnail-svc leaked
// roughly 40MB/hour under sustained load because evicted entries kept a
// strong reference to their decode buffers. Fixed in 3.2.1 by clearing
// the buffer pointer on eviction; soak tests over 72 hours show flat
// heap usage. The client below must still authenticate against the
// internal Pixelbarn metrics endpoint to report cache stats. The key
// used for that reporting call is as follows.

API key for yahig-tadup: kto7_ubizbYm

Plugin authors: the v9 release changes the locker-open handshake. Your plugin must request a scoped access grant before issuing unlock commands; the old direct-unlock path is removed. Grants expire after 90 seconds and are single-use. Test against the Bramwick sandbox before publishing. Submissions without a passing handshake conformance run are rejected automatically. All plugin bundles must be signed prior to upload, and the registry verifies the signature at install time. Sign releases with the key below.

deploy key for kajof-fajop: bky6_gDHw9Q